Position Summary Information

Job Description Summary

After attending course lectures, the SI Leader will conduct and prepare for organized, collaborative group study sessions on a weekly basis. The ideal candidate must possess strong communication skills, the ability to engage students, enjoy the subject matter, and have a passion for learning and applying new skills and strategies to enhance student learning.

Responsibilities
  • Attend lectures for target SI courses.
  • Complete professional development activities
  • Conduct weekly organized study sessions.
  • Prepare for each session, which may include hand-outs and worksheets.
  • Record session attendance.
  • Attend orientation, monthly meetings, and other meetings scheduled as needed.
  • Complete all assignments/documentation required by TLC and Payroll on time.
  • Meet with course faculty weekly.
  • Conduct weekly office hours in the TLC
  • Promote the SI Program and weekly sessions.
Required Qualifications
  • A GPA of 3.0 or better
  • A grade of A or A- in the course (or equivalent course) for which you lead
  • Faculty Recommendation
  • Outstanding time management skills
  • Ability to learn and apply new skills and strategies to enhance collaboration for student learning
  • Promote the SI program and tutoring
  • Ability to follow policy and procedures set by TLC and Chapman University
  • Responsible and committed to those being served
